Mediation

Workplace Mediation is an impartial, confidential, safe and cost effective way of defusing conflict between individuals or teams when all parties need to continue their working relationship.

It is a specific structured approach where an impartial mediator enables communication between those in dispute.  The mediator provides a safe and confidential space where through facilitated discussion disputants learn to understand each other and come up with mutually acceptable solutions that will improve their working relationship.

Mediation is suitable for all types of disputes at all levels within the organisations.

Win/Win Solutions

Mediation designed to achieve a win/win solution that is designed by the disputants themselves. In all other types of conflict resolution the emphasis is either adversarial resulting in one side losing as in litigation or a compromise as in negotiation or arbitration.
